A damp basement can be a real headache, leading to musty odors, mold growth, and even structural damage. The best way to manage this problem is to be proactive before leaks actually occur. First, inspect your basement walls and foundation for any holes. These can allow water to seep in during heavy rains or snowmelt.

After that, make sure your gutters are clean and directing water past your foundation. It's also important to maintain your sump pump regularly to ensure it's ready to handle excess liquid.

  • Consider installing a perimeter drain to divert water away from your foundation.
  • Regularly inspect the areas around your basement windows and doors for gaps and fix them as soon as possible.

Eliminate Basement Flooding

A flooded basement can be a major headache, generating water damage and safety hazards. But don't panic! With swift action, you can dry the water and reduce further damage. First, identify the source of the flooding to prevent more from happening. Next, launch removing standing water with pumps or wet/dry vacuums. Spread absorbent materials like towels and kitty litter to soak up remaining moisture. Be sure to ventilate the basement to help it dry faster.

Once the water is gone, check for any damage to your foundation. Mend any damaged areas promptly to prevent mold growth and further structural problems.

Remember, time is of the essence when dealing with a flooded basement. The faster you respond, the less damage will occur.
